NORTHERN MICHIGAN EQUINE THERAPY

Based in BOYNE CITY, MI, NORTHERN MICHIGAN EQUINE THERAPY operates as a Public Charity. The organization reported $298K in revenue, $268K in expenses, $291K in total assets for fiscal year 2024. Financial Trends

Year Revenue Expenses Assets
2024 $298K $268K $291K
2023 $259K $215K $268K
2022 $196K $191K $223K
2020 $206K $160K $219K
2019 $257K $192K $181K

Between 2019 and 2024, reported annual revenue grew from $257K to $298K (+16%), with total assets most recently reported at $291K.
